首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

从文档中提取文本块并将其写入新的文本文件

是一种文本处理操作,可以通过编程实现。以下是一个完善且全面的答案:

文本块提取是指从一个文档中抽取出特定的文本段落或区域。这个过程可以通过文本分析和处理技术来实现。一般来说,文本块提取可以分为以下几个步骤:

  1. 文本预处理:首先需要对原始文档进行预处理,包括去除文档中的特殊字符、标点符号、HTML标签等,以及进行大小写转换、词干提取等操作,以便后续的文本分析。
  2. 文本分析:接下来,可以使用自然语言处理(NLP)技术对文本进行分析,例如分词、词性标注、命名实体识别等。这些分析技术可以帮助我们理解文本的结构和语义。
  3. 文本块提取:在文本分析的基础上,可以根据特定的规则或模式,提取出我们感兴趣的文本块。例如,可以通过正则表达式匹配特定的文本模式,或者使用关键词匹配等方法来提取目标文本块。
  4. 文本写入:最后,将提取到的文本块写入新的文本文件中。可以使用编程语言提供的文件操作函数,将文本块逐行写入新的文件中,或者将文本块作为一个整体写入文件。

这种文本块提取和写入操作在很多场景下都有应用,例如从大型文档集合中提取关键信息、从网页中抽取新闻内容、从日志文件中提取错误信息等。在云计算领域,这种操作可以用于处理大规模的文本数据,例如在数据分析、机器学习、信息检索等任务中。

腾讯云提供了一系列与文本处理相关的产品和服务,包括自然语言处理(NLP)服务、文本分析API、文本转语音服务等。您可以通过腾讯云的文本处理产品和服务,实现从文档中提取文本块并将其写入新的文本文件的功能。具体产品和服务的介绍和链接地址,请参考腾讯云官方文档:

  1. 自然语言处理(NLP)服务:提供了一系列文本处理的API,包括分词、词性标注、命名实体识别等功能。详情请参考:腾讯云自然语言处理(NLP)服务
  2. 文本分析API:提供了文本分类、情感分析、关键词提取等功能的API接口。详情请参考:腾讯云文本分析API
  3. 文本转语音服务:可以将文本转换为语音,并保存为音频文件。详情请参考:腾讯云文本转语音服务

通过使用腾讯云的文本处理产品和服务,您可以方便地实现从文档中提取文本块并将其写入新的文本文件的需求。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

文本文件读取博客数据并将其提取到文件

通常情况下我们可以使用 Python 文件操作来实现这个任务。下面是一个简单示例,演示了如何从一个文本文件读取博客数据,并将其提取到另一个文件。...假设你博客数据文件(例如 blog_data.txt)格式1、问题背景我们需要从包含博客列表文本文件读取指定数量博客(n)。然后提取博客数据并将其添加到文件。...它只能在直接给出链接时工作,例如:page = urllib2.urlopen("http://www.frugalrules.com")我们另一个脚本调用这个函数,用户在其中给出输入n。...with open('data.txt', 'a') as f: f.write(...)请注意,file是open弃用形式(它在Python3被删除)。...,提取每个博客数据标题、作者、日期和正文内容,然后将这些数据写入到 extracted_blog_data.txt 文件

10610
  • 一种 Au3 远控木马变种样本分析

    0x03变种木马分析 3.1 可疑文件 可疑文件被嵌入在某文档,以邮件方式进行传播: ? 提取出可执行程序样本后,发现该样本为 RAR 自解压程序: ?...任意打开压缩包内文本文件发现,这些文本文件内容都是一些字符串,此处推测这些文件存在目的可能是为了欺骗杀软对压缩包内容检测: ?...为了构造攻击所需 “payload”,脚本程序会配置文件读取加密代码段及解密密钥。 当一系列攻击操作完成时,被入侵主机会主动向 C&C 服务器发起回连请求。...FileRead:用于读取配置文件加密代码。 FileSetAttrib:用于设置文件属性。 FileWrite:用于写入解密后脚本到新文件。...提取五次注入内存,即得到注入到 RegSvcs.exe 进程 DLL 完整数据,我们将其命名为 inject.dll。

    2.4K70

    Python权威指南10个项目(1~5

    文本文件进行分析后,你甚至可以执行其他任务,如提取所有的标题以制作目录。...生成文本时,将其包含所有行合并, #并将两端多余空白(如列表项缩进和换行符)删除,得到一个表示文本字符串。...下面先来列出一些潜在组件: 解析器:添加一个读取文本管理其他类对象。 规则:对于每种文本,都制定一条相应规则。这些规则能够检测不同类型文本 相应地设置其格式。...最后,可创建一个默认规则,用于处理段落,即其他规则未处理所有文本。各个不同复杂文档规则已经在代码解释。   ...具体地说,你将创建一个PDF文件,其中包含图表对 文本文件读取数据进行了可视化。虽然常规电子表格软件都提供这样功能,但Python提 供了更强大功能。

    82410

    Python实现PD文字识别、提取写入CSV文件脚本分享

    二、需求描述 现有一份pdf扫描件,我们想把其中文字提取出来并且分三列写入csv文档,内容及效果如下: pdfexample csvexample 三、开始动手动脑 pdf扫描件是文档扫描成电脑图片格式后转化成...(pdf_path, lang, first_page, last_page) 将pdf文件拆分成图片,并提取文字写入文本文件 pdf_path:pdf文件存储路径 image:代表PDF文档每页PIL...3.4 对识别的数据进行处理,写入csv文件 modification(infile, outfile) 清洗生成文本文档 infile:需要进行处理文件地址 outfile:处理后生成新文件地址...image-20211215203123576 image-20211215212227592 writercsv(intxt,outcsv) 将文本文件按空格分列写入csv表格 intxt:文本文件地址...原因是这个被加密pdf可能是从高版本acrobot,所以对应加密算法代号为‘4’,然而,现有的pypdf2模块只支持加密算法代号为‘1’或者‘2’pdf加密文件。

    3.3K30

    600个常用Linux命令大全,A到Z

    col 用于过滤掉反向换行,col 实用程序只是标准输入读取写入标准输出 colcrt 用于格式化文本处理器输出,以便可以在阴极射线管显示器上查看 colrm 文件删除选定列 column...dos2unix 将 DOS 文本文件转换为 UNIX 格式 dosfsck 诊断 MS-DOS 文件系统问题尝试修复它们 dstat 用于系统组件(例如网络连接、IO 设备或 CPU 等)检索信息或统计信息...fmt 用作简化和优化文本文件格式化程序 fold 将输入文件每一行包装起来以适应指定宽度并将其打印到标准输出 for 用于对列表存在每个元素重复执行一组命令 free 显示可用空间总量以及系统中使用内存量和交换内存量...stty 用于更改和打印终端线路设置 sudo 用作某些仅允许超级用户运行命令前缀 sum 用于查找校验和计算文件数 sync 用于将缓存写入同步到持久存储 systemctl 用于检查和控制...“systemd”系统和服务管理器状态 T 命令 描述 tac 用于反向连接和打印文件 tail 打印给定输入最后 N 个数据 tar 用于创建存档并提取存档文件 tee 读取标准输入并将其写入标准输出和一个或多个文件

    48411

    Linux命令大全,A到Z都有总结,封神之作!

    ,默认情况下,它显示当前月份日历作为输出 case 当我们不得不在单个变量上使用多个 if/elif 时,这是最好选择 cat 文件读取数据并将其内容作为输出 cc 用于编译 C 语言代码创建可执行文件...ed 用于启动 ed 文本编辑器,它是一个基于行文本编辑器,具有最小界面,这使得处理文本文件复杂性降低,即创建、编辑、显示和操作文件 egrep 将模式视为扩展正则表达式打印出与模式匹配行...fmt 用作简化和优化文本文件格式化程序 fold 将输入文件每一行包装起来以适应指定宽度并将其打印到标准输出 for 用于对列表存在每个元素重复执行一组命令...sum 用于查找校验和计算文件数 sync 用于将缓存写入同步到持久存储...tar 用于创建存档并提取存档文件 tee 读取标准输入并将其写入标准输出和一个或多个文件

    2.3K02

    【深入浅出C#】章节 7: 文件和输入输出操作:处理文本和二进制数据

    文本数据是最常见数据类型之一,用于存储和传输可读字符信息。文本文件在配置文件、日志记录和文档中广泛使用。...; writer.WriteLine("This is a text file."); } 文本文件读取和写入是处理文本数据基本操作,可以在日志记录、配置文件、文档处理等场景中广泛应用。...我们使用一个字节数组 buffer 来存储文件读取数据。在循环中,我们使用 Read 方法文件流读取数据,并将其转换为字符串打印出来。...文本文件处理:对于文本文件,可以进行搜索、替换、分割等操作。 图像和音频处理:将图像、音频等媒体文件写入文件或文件读取,进行处理和编辑。...人类可读性:如果文件内容需要被人类读取,例如报告、说明文档等,文本文件更容易理解。 跨平台性:文本文件在不同操作系统间兼容性较好,易于跨平台共享。

    72580

    一文搞定Python读取文件全部知识

    在上面的代码,open() 函数以只读模式打开文本文件,这允许我们文件获取信息而不能更改它。...在第一行,open() 函数输出被赋值给一个代表文本文件对象 f,在第二行,我们使用 read() 方法读取整个文件打印其内容,close() 方法在最后一行关闭文件。...rb' 模式以二进制模式打开文件并进行读取,而 'wb' 模式以文本模式打开文件以并行写入 读取文本文件 在 Python 中有多种读取文本文件方法,下面我们介绍一些读取文本文件内容有用方法 到目前为止...它是一个字符串列表,其中列表每个项目都是文本文件一行,``\n` 转义字符表示文件行。...JSON 文件并将其作为 JSON 对象使用,而不是作为文本文件,为此我们需要导入 JSON 模块。

    2K50

    在 Python 创建和修改 PDF 文件

    您可以通过单击以下链接下载示例中使用材料: PDF 中提取文本 在本节,您将学习如何阅读 PDF 文件使用PyPDF2包提取文本。...让我们结合您所学一切,编写一个程序,Pride_and_Prejudice.pdf文件中提取所有文本将其保存到.txt文件。...with 然后,在with内,使用 .pdf 将 PDF 标题和页数写入文本文件output_file.write()。 最后,您使用for循环遍历 PDF 所有页面。... PDF 中提取页面 在上一节,您学习了如何 PDF 文件中提取所有文本将其保存到.txt文件。现在,您将学习如何现有 PDF 中提取页面或页面范围并将它们保存到 PDF。... PDF 中提取多个页面 让我们从中提取第一章Pride_and_Prejudice.pdf并将其保存为 PDF。

    12.9K70

    Python Excel数据简单处理记录

    Python Excel数据简单处理记录 正在备研大三把不少东西忘一干二净我,花了两个小时对Pythonpandas库进行复健最后实现老师那边提出要求,这里是一些记录 要提取Excel文件行...print(column_name, ":", value) print() 为实现可读性要求,简单对代码进行处理将其存放在txt文档里,完整代码如下 import pandas...test_question_831.xls') # 获取有效列名列表 column_names = df.columns.tolist() # 打印有效列名 print(column_names) # 打开文本文件写入模式...row_data = row # 输出整行数据写入文本文件 file.write(f"Row {index}\n") for column_name..., value in row_data.iteritems(): # 如果列不为空,则输出列名和对应写入文本文件 if not pd.isnull(

    13910

    【深入浅出C#】章节 7: 文件和输入输出操作:文件读写和流操作

    二、文本文件读写 2.1 文本文件读取和写入 文本文件读取和写入是常见文件操作任务,在C#可以使用StreamReader和StreamWriter来实现。...三、二进制文件读写 3.1 二进制文件读取和写入 二进制文件读取和写入文本文件有所不同,因为二进制文件包含是以字节为单位数据,而不是文本文件字符。...文本文件操作:文件流也支持读取和写入文本文件,可以方便地对文本文件进行读取、查找、替换等操作。 文件复制和移动:通过文件流,可以轻松实现文件复制和移动。 文件流在计算机编程是非常重要和常用概念。...通过文件读写,可以将应用程序运行时日志信息记录到文件,方便开发人员进行分析和调试。 文本处理:文件读写可以用于文本文件读取和写入。例如,处理文本文件、日志文件、配置文件、报表等。...序列化和反序列化:将对象序列化为字节流保存到文件,或文件读取字节流反序列化为对象,是数据持久化和跨平台数据传输重要方式。

    2.8K50

    python文件操作读取文件写入文件

    读取文件 要使用文本文件信息,首先需要将信息读取到内存。为此,你可以一次性读取文件全部内容,也可以以每次一行方式逐步读取。 读取整个文件 要读取文件,需要一个包含几行文本文件。...如果要在 with 代码外访问文件内容,可在 with 代码内将文件各行存储在一个列表,并在 with 代码外使用该列表:你可以立即处理文件各个部分,也可推迟到程序后面再处理。...包含一百万位大型文件 前面我们分析都是一个只有三行文本文件,但这些代码示例也可处理大得多文件。...写入文件 保存数据最简单方式之一是将其写入到文件。通过将输出写入文件,即便关闭包含程序输出终端窗口,这些输出也依然存在。...Python 只能将字符串写入文本文件。要将数值数据存储到文本文件,必须先使用函数 str() 将其转换为字符串格式。

    11.2K96

    Python 自动化指南(繁琐工作自动化)第二版:十五、使用 PDF 和 WORD 文档

    PDF 中提取文本 PyPDF2 无法 PDF 文档提取图像、图表或其他媒体,但它可以提取文本将其作为 Python 字符串返回。...示例 PDF 有 19 页,但是让我们只第一页提取文本。 要从页面中提取文本,您需要从一个PdfFileReader对象获取一个Page对象,它代表 PDF 一个页面。...docx文件获取全文 如果您只关心 Word 文档文本,而不是样式信息,您可以使用getText()函数。它接受.docx文件名返回其文本单个字符串值。...这将打开“格式创建样式”对话框,您可以在其中输入样式。然后,返回交互式 shell,用docx.Document()打开这个空白 Word 文档将其作为 Word 文档基础。...add_paragraph()文档方法向文档添加一段文本返回对添加Paragraph对象引用。

    3.6K50

    Python文件处理–为初学者学习Python文件处理

    文本文件由一系列行构成。并且,文本文件每一行都包含一个字符序列。文本文件每行终止都以行尾(EOL)表示。有一些特殊字符可以用作EOL,但逗号{,}和换行符是最常见字符。...说,这就是我们文本文件“ demofile.txt”样子: 这只是一个文本文件 但这是换行符 现在,这里是一个代码片段,可使用Python文件处理功能打开文件。...f= open(‘demofile.txt’, ‘r’) f.readline() 借助Pythonopen函数读取文本文件将其保存在文件对象借助readlines函数读取行。...请记住,f.readline()文件对象读取一行。另外,此函数在字符串末尾保留换行符(\ n)。 “这只是一个文本文件,\n” 写入文件 write()方法用于将字符串写入文件。...请记住,如果它为负 或 无,它将读取到文件末尾 readline(n = -1) 文件读取返回一行。请记住,如果指定,它最多读取 n个字节 阅读线(n = -1) 文件读取返回行列表。

    14530

    文件和文件异常

    读取一个文本文件内容,重新设置这些数据格式并将其写入文件,让浏览器能够显示这些内容。 要使用文件文件信息,首先需要将信息读取到内存。...使用方法read()读取这个文件全部内容,并将其作为一个长长字符串存储在变量contents。通过打印contents值,就可将这个文本文件全部内容显示出来。 为什么多出个空行?...方法readlines()文件读取每一行,并将其存储在一个列表。接下来,该列表被存储到变量lines。在with代码外,我们依然可以使用这个变量。...获得一个这样字符串:它包含精确到30位小数圆周率值。这个字符串长32字符,因为它还包含整数部分3和小数点。 读取文本文件时,Python将其所有文本都解读为字符串。...要将数值数据存储到文本文件,必须先使用函数str()将其转换为字符串格式。 ? 输出: ? 2.写入多行 函数write()不会在写入文本末尾添加换行符,如果写入多行时没有指定换行符: ?

    5.2K20

    【JavaSE专栏71】File类文件读写,对计算机文件进行读取和写入操作

    我们使用 BufferedReader 来读取文本文件逐行打印文件内容。...我们使用 BufferedWriter 来写入文本文件。...通过读取源文件内容并将其写入目标文件,可以轻松实现文件复制、移动和同步。 图像和多媒体处理:Java 文件读写功能也可以用于图像和多媒体文件处理。...---- 四、文件读写面试题 请简要解释Java字节流和字符流区别。 在 Java ,如何使用字节流读取文本文件?请提供相关代码示例。 什么是 Java 序列化和反序列化?...五、总结 本文讲解了 Java File 类文件读写方式,也演示了 Java 读写 txt 文档流程,给出了样例代码,在下一篇博客,将讲解字符流 Reader 类用法。

    35840

    Python爬虫之文件存储#5

    所以如果对检索和数据结构要求不高,追求方便第一的话,可以采用 TXT 文本存储。本节,我们就来看下如何利用 Python 保存 TXT 文本文件。 1....首先,用 requests 提取知乎 “发现” 页面,然后将热门话题问题、回答者、答案全文提取出来,然后利用 Python 提供 open 方法打开一个文本文件,获取一个文件操作对象,这里赋值为...file,接着利用 file 对象 write 方法将提取内容写入文件,最后调用 close 方法将其关闭,这样抓取内容即可成功写入文本中了。...打开方式 在刚才实例,open 方法第二个参数设置成了 a,这样在每次写入文本时不会清空源文件,而是在文件末尾写入内容,这是一种文件打开方式。...如果 JSON 文本读取内容,例如这里有一个 data.json 文本文件,其内容是刚才定义 JSON 字符串,我们可以先将文本文件内容读出,然后再利用 loads 方法转化: import json

    15710

    《看漫画学python》第十一天-文件读写

    • encoding参数用来指定打开文件时文件编码。 • errors参数用来指定在文本文件发生编码错误时如何处理。...在finally代码关闭文件 在with as代码关闭文件 读写文本文件 • read(size=-1):文件读取字符串,size限制读取字符数,size=-1指对读取字符数没有限制...• write(s):将字符串s写入文件返回写入字符数。 • writelines(lines):向文件写入一个字符串列表。不添加行分隔符,因此通常为每一行末尾都提供行分隔符。...• flush():刷新写缓冲区,在文件没有关闭情况下将数据写入文件。 复制文本文件 读写二进制文件 二进制文件读写单位是字节,不需要考虑编码问题。二进制文件主要读写方法如下。...• read(size=-1):文件读取字节,size限制读取字节数,如果size=-1,则读取全部字节。 • readline(size=-1):文件读取返回一行。

    18820
    领券